传统型程序员必备技能:泛型、枚举、反射
1.定义:泛型:通过参数化类型,提高代码的复用性,并在编译期间强制进行类型检查。
默认Object
- 参数化类型
- 提高代码的复用性
- 编译期强制进行类型检查
- 泛型接口
- 泛型类
- 泛型方法
如List的源码中:
单个泛型的使用:
多个泛型的使用: 尖括号里面,逗号隔开
在方法的返回值前面添加一个<>引入泛型,即可!
extends :上边界,只能传本类或者子类
super:下边界,只能传本类或父类

传统型程序员必备技能:泛型、枚举、反射
1.定义:泛型:通过参数化类型,提高代码的复用性,并在编译期间强制进行类型检查。
默认Object
如List的源码中:
单个泛型的使用:
多个泛型的使用: 尖括号里面,逗号隔开
在方法的返回值前面添加一个<>引入泛型,即可!
extends :上边界,只能传本类或者子类
super:下边界,只能传本类或父类